TDD Alignment (Step 2)
Core mental model
The TDD is the bridge between what (PRD) and how-to-test (later steps). Misalignment here propagates downstream: an acceptance criterion with no test design becomes an acceptance criterion with no test, becomes a feature shipped without proof.
What it produces
TDD_ALIGNMENT.md with:
- Coverage table: each PRD acceptance criterion → TDD test strategy
- PHI handling table: each L3/L4 field → desensitization step in TDD
- Stage validation table: each PRD stage → TDD's stage-level test plan
- Gaps list (sorted by severity)

Workflow
- Extract PRD acceptance criteria into a flat list (numbered).
- For each criterion, find the TDD section that addresses it; record (criterion → tdd-section + test-strategy).
- Any criterion without a target → gap.
- For every L3/L4 field in COMPLIANCE_TAG, locate desensitization plan in TDD; missing → gap.
- For every PRD stage, locate the corresponding TDD stage validation; missing → gap.
- Emit report; if gaps exist, suggest concrete TDD patches.

Common failure modes
- "Tests will be written later" handwave: TDD says "comprehensive testing" without naming approach. Mitigation: require strategy name from
reference/test-strategy-catalog.md.
- Forgotten staging tests: PRD has 3 stages, TDD only describes final-state tests. Mitigation: per-stage row in alignment table.
- PHI assumed handled by infra: developer assumes desensitize happens "somewhere". Mitigation: explicit row per field.
